Parisian Door No. 15 metal print by Joey Agbayani.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

Artist's Description
Aside from the awesome historical landmarks, there is so much more to see in Paris. Everywhere you go, you see a lot of interesting decors, architectural elements and details. Here is one of hundreds of fascinating doors you'll find in Paris.
About Joey Agbayani
"I am a filmmaker. I do matte paintings, traditional and 3D CGI animation, graphic visual effects, cinematography, and photography. Painting is my most favorite art form. Compared to film production, the process of making a painting has practically no budget constraints and there is so much creative freedom. A blank piece of canvas excites me- there are no limitations or boundaries in terms of creativity. "My interest in painting began at the age of 10. I remember using watercolor- copying photographs from travel books. I learned painting through the rendering classes at the University of the Philippines (UP) College of Architecture, workshops at the UP College of Fine Arts, and from reading art books.
